Ed Harris plays the leader of a biker gang called Cymbeline, perfectly. Ethan Hawke, is there....cool, I guess? The acting plays a big part in the film, because this is a more action story driven movie, Milia Jovovich plays the most haunting, " Cymbeliny" Queen you will ever see. The story, for the most part is mishmash, cut in pieces and stuck with wafer thin glue, called "the ending". But it tries a lot, the action is great when it comes, and the acting is good. Almeryda's passion for Shakepeare shows out in this movie, it dazzles, it's electryfiying in the opening 40 minutes and it has a shocking plot twist. If the bad things can improve, Micheal Almeryda's Cymbeline may be the freshest, most badass Shakepeare film adaptation in years. Expand
